Position Summary
Ensures area of responsibility is maintained in accordance with company policies and procedures by properly handling returns, zoning the area, arranging and organizing merchandise, and identifying shrink and damages. Provides member service by maintaining exit areas, reviewing member receipts, acknowledging the member, and identifying member needs. Assists members with purchasing decisions, locating merchandise, and processing member purchases. Assists with securing and safeguarding Sam's Club assets and property by observing and communicating potential criminal activity, maintaining paperwork logs, and ensuring compliance with company security and safety practices. Assists with the training of Member Frontline Service associates on company processes and procedures, teaching new technology and tool functionality, delivering new program rollout training, and providing continuous learning and process improvement opportunities. Complies with company policies, procedures, and standards of ethics and integrity by implementing related action plans. Completes work assignments and priorities by using policies, data, and resources, collaborating with managers, coworkers, customers, and other business partners. At Sam's Club, we offer competitive pay as well as performance-based bonus awards and other great benefits for a happier mind, body, and wallet! Health benefits include medical, vision, and dental coverage. Financial benefits include 401(k), stock purchase, and company-paid life insurance. Paid time off benefits include PTO, parental leave, family care leave, bereavement, jury duty, and voting. You will also receive PTO and / or PPTO that can be used for vacation, sick leave, holidays, or other purposes. The amount you receive depends on your job classification and length of employment. It will meet or exceed the requirements of paid sick leave laws, where applicable. For information about PTO, see https : / / one.walmart.com / notices . Other benefits include short-term and long-term disability, company discounts, Military Leave Pay, adoption and surrogacy expense reimbursement, and more. Live Better U is a company-paid education benefit program for full-time and part-time associates in Walmart and Sam's Club facilities. Programs range from high school completion to bachelor's degrees, including English Language Learning and short-form certificates. Tuition, books, and fees are completely paid for by Walmart. Eligibility requirements apply to some benefits and may depend on your job classification and length of employment. Benefits are subject to change and may be subject to a specific plan or program terms. For information about benefits and eligibility, see One.Walmart at https : / / bit.ly / 3iOOb1J .
The hourly wage range for this position is $18.00 to $25.00. The actual hourly rate will equal or exceed the required minimum wage applicable to the job location. Additional compensation in the form of premiums may be paid in amounts ranging from $0.35 per hour to $3.00 per hour in specific circumstances. Premiums may be based on schedule, facility, season, or specific work performed. Multiple premiums may apply if applicable criteria are met.
